im trying to locate the adjustment procedures for the shifter on the 69 4 speeed,its a big block car,recently it started hanging up in reverse and lately been having a hard time getting into most gears,doesnt grind ....just doesnt want to go.anyone?
If you look closely at the rear of the levers that are on the shifter itself, you will see small indentions. When the proper adjustment of the rods are made the indentions will line up.
In neutral, you should be able to slide a 1/4" drill bit clear thru all 3 levers. It will fit into the indentations on both sides of the shifter case as well.
Note that your problem sounds like a clutch adjustment, not releasing all the way. Adjust the rod from the Z-bar to the cluth fork a little longer and try it. I like the clutch to just "load" the motor 4" off the floor. If all the linkage is right that should leave you with an inch of freeplay at the top.
